COVID-19 Assay

A new Covid19 Clinical Assay has been developed on rare skin diseases thanks to our European and French Networks!

"COVID-19 and rare skin diseases. European observational study (data research) during an epidemic".

This study concerns paediatric and adult patients with rare skin diseases and suspected or confirmed COVID-19 infection who consult a medical team that is part of the European Reference Network ERN-Skin or the Rare Skin Diseases Health Network (FIMARAD). Professor Christine Bodemer (Hôpital Necker-Enfants malades, Paris, France) is the principal investigator.

The main objective of this European observational cohort study (research data) is to determine the impact of a COVID-19 virus infection in a cohort of patients with rare skin diseases and particularly if these rare diseases and their treatments are risk factors of infection severity.

This study is under registration on the following website :  https://clinicaltrials.gov/

Registry

 
 
 
 
 
 
   
 

The ERN-Skin registry prototype is ready!

Funding to create the new ERN-Skin registry has been received! 

The project in its first phase has started and is looking at a first delivery of the registry with the minimum dataset.

A prototype is due to be delivered on the 15th of June. A few expert users will be trained on it and will use it in a test environment. Outcome of tests will be shared with the different groups of the project.  

 
   
 
 

CPMS

 
 
 
 
 
 
   
 

More ERN-Skin CPMS users!

Activity on CPMS has been reduced since March due to Covid-19 crisis, for all ERNs. However, new panels are now being initiated, new meetings are due to take place in June for ERN-Skin, week 26.

 
 

Some history can be interesting to look at. The activity on CPMS for ERN-Skin has been slowly increasing over time, and more rapidly since mid-2019. ERN-Skin is showing an interest for sharing patient cases over this tool; the increase is quite remarkable and this was highlighted by the European Commission in a recent analysis.
